Details: The Technical Specialist, Web and Applications will undertake day to day operational support of assigned systems and infrastructure used and supported by the ACT Health Directorate and will work in the Technical Services Hub to support a large number of critical health applications.
The position will: Install and maintain Microsoft servers including web and printing services.Work within a team to support web application and deploy a large number of clinical applications within the Health Protected Enclave using deployment technologies including Citrix technologies.Monitor system performance and troubleshoot issues, including through developing and maintaining scripts to improve system management tasks.Assist in the configuration and troubleshooting of integration third party software and peripherals.Liaise with service providers and all relevant stakeholders in relation to system support, maintenance and enhancements.Engage with Project Teams to deliver assigned work packages, or provide technical input.Undertake investigation, research and audit activities relating to assigned ICT tasks.Develop and maintain relevant technical documentation and corporate policies.Undertake other duties appropriate to this level of classification that contribute to the division of the ACTHD.Highly desirable: Experience in Microsoft Windows server and desktop operating systems.Experience with hardware or software load balancing solutions.Certification and experience in application deployment platforms such as Citrix and/or Microsoft System Centre Configuration Manager.Working knowledge of Internet Information Services (IIS) administration.Working knowledge of network protocols and functionality including TCP/IP, Active Directory, Domain Name Services, FTP/SCP, and HTTP/S.Eligibility/Other Requirements: We are committed to creating an inclusive environment where people with diverse thoughts, lived experience, and perspectives can thrive and contribute their unique talents to the ACTPS and ACT community.
